Output 26e159a6f0549f664343aff9595a7ffae4c857ea9d87eb2d3909e9f0cf100742:0

value
39851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 818235a84668390c4215cb2f06e0161cb19858de OP_EQUAL
address
3DVo5QpGDBgdXwABcGwhAjx7yFKiDokVDn
transaction
26e159a6f0549f664343aff9595a7ffae4c857ea9d87eb2d3909e9f0cf100742
spent
true